ExcelBanter

ExcelBanter (https://www.excelbanter.com/)
-   Excel Programming (https://www.excelbanter.com/excel-programming/)
-   -   Changing header text from one page to another (https://www.excelbanter.com/excel-programming/427342-re-changing-header-text-one-page-another.html)

JLGWhiz[_2_]

Changing header text from one page to another
 
My understanding of how Excel works with a printer is that when you tell it
to print, it creates a print file based on what you have previously entered
for parameters in the page set-up options, including print ranges and page
breaks. That is what and how it will print. AFIK, there is no facility to
printing instructions in real time during the print operation. Fixed range
headers and custom headers and footers have to be determined in advance of
the print command.

You probably didn't want to hear this.


"Peter Facey" wrote in message
...
My spreadsheet contains a large number of names and addresses, one per
row.
When printing it, I want to throw a new page when the street name changes
and
also to put the new street name into the page header.

I can easily run down the rows inserting page breaks when the street name
changes, but is there any way of changing the header text dynamically?

Two thoughts occurred:
* is it possible to execute a vba procedure during printing every time the
top or bottom of a page is reached (one can in Access)?
* is it possible to make the header text a function of a cell value on the
page about to be printed?





All times are GMT +1. The time now is 10:56 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
ExcelBanter.com